Quantcast
Channel: Active questions tagged python - Stack Overflow
Viewing all articles
Browse latest Browse all 23131

displaying choice in django admin

$
0
0

im making a reservation app, i want one of the ways to see the data being in the admin panel but right now i can see everything except for the time, i think it is because its a choice field and in the admin it appears like it wasnt chosen.

models.py

class Reservation(models.Model):    name = models.CharField(max_length=50)    people = models.IntegerField()    date = models.DateField()    time_choice = (        (times_available[0], times_available[0]),        (times_available[1], times_available[1]),        (times_available[2], times_available[2]),        (times_available[3], times_available[3]),        (times_available[4], times_available[4]),        (times_available[5], times_available[5]),        (times_available[6], times_available[6])    )    time = models.CharField(        max_length= 7,        blank= True,        null= True,        choices= time_choice    )    phone = models.IntegerField()    def __str__(self):        return self.name

views.py

def reservar_mesa(request):    reserve_form = FormReservarMesa()    if request.method == 'POST':        reserve_form = FormReservarMesa(request.POST)        if reserve_form.is_valid():            reserve_form.save()            reserve_form = FormReservarMesa()            return HttpResponseRedirect("/home/")    context = {'form' : reserve_form}    return render(request, 'reservas.html', context)

my admin.py is the deafault.i checked and the value is being stored in the database


Viewing all articles
Browse latest Browse all 23131

Trending Articles



<script src="https://jsc.adskeeper.com/r/s/rssing.com.1596347.js" async> </script>